Oklahoma City Thunder | Game #28 Preview: Minnesota Timberwolves

The Oklahoma City Thunder suffered from poor shooting and questionable defense on Saturday at home against the Los Angeles Lakers, and the result was a 129-120 thanks primarily to the hot-shooting from Lebron James and Co. OKC looks to get back on track on Tuesday night as they host the Minnesota Timberwolves, who are currently atop the Western Conference standings.

The Wolves are similar to the Thunder in that they are a young, well-balanced team ready to emerge as a legit contender in the West. Anthony Edwards and Karl-Anthony Towns are both solid offensive threats, and Rudy Gobert is a three-time NBA Defensive Player of the Year. While Minnesota falls into the middle of pack when it comes to their offensive capabilities, they are one of the top defensive teams in the NBA.

Oklahoma City is going to have to shoot the ball a lot better than they did on Saturday, but that can’t be their only focus, and it probably shouldn’t be the primary one either. The Thunder is at their best when they are playing well on both ends of the floor, and it typically starts with the defense. OKC is going to have to lock in and go to battle down low, as Gobert and Towns are two of the better big men in the league. If the Thunder can compete in rebounding the basketball, then they have a good chance at giving Thunder fans a late Christmas present.

Head-to-Head

  • Since arriving in Oklahoma City in 2008, the Thunder is 36-23 against the Timberwolves (18-10 at home, 18-13 on the road).
  • Since arriving in Oklahoma City in 2008, the Thunder has won the 4-game regular season series against the Timberwolves 9 times, lost it 3 times, and tied it twice.
  • The Thunder went 1-4 against the Timberwolves last season, including the Play-In Game (0-2 at home, 1-2 on the road).
  • The Thunder is 0-1 against the Timberwolves so far this season (0-0 at home, 0-1 on the road).
